bishul akum

  • a jew must be involved at some level - for sefardim, a jew must put food on the stove
  • pilot lights in extreme situations
  • exempt: foods that can be eaten raw & unimportant food

tevillat kelim
Photo by Rmonty119

criterea

  • material
  • how is it used
  • who made it
  • who owns it
Photo by freefotouk

materials

  • required: metals and glass
  • glass
  • wood / stone / rubber / plastic
Photo by kino-eye

usage

  • anything used in preparations or serving
  • in contact with food
  • bring the food to an edible state (without a bracha)
Photo by chefranden

making vs owning

  • jewish made items do not require tevila
  • only jewish owned items must be tovelled
Photo by Dan Gutwein

how to tovel

  • remove stickers, dirt and food
  • immerse the entire item
  • al tevilat kli / kelim

electrical appliances

  • don't do anything dangerous!
  • for many appliances, the part that requires tevila can be removed
